WOMAD, which stands for World of Music, Arts and Dance, is one of the world's most celebrated multicultural festivals, bringing together artists, musicians, performers, speakers, chefs, and creative communities from every continent. Founded with the vision of promoting cultural understanding through music and the arts, the festival has become a globally recognized event that attracts thousands of visitors each year. The festival celebrates diversity by presenting performances that span traditional folk music, contemporary world music, dance, visual arts, storytelling, culinary experiences, wellness activities, and educational workshops.
The modern edition of WOMAD is hosted at the beautiful Neston Park Estate in North Wiltshire, offering visitors a unique countryside setting with spacious festival grounds, family-friendly facilities, camping areas, and immersive cultural experiences. Guests enjoy an atmosphere where creativity, sustainability, and global collaboration come together over several unforgettable days.
Live Music and Cultural Experiences
Music remains at the heart of WOMAD. Multiple performance stages showcase internationally acclaimed artists alongside emerging musicians from countries around the globe. Genres range from African rhythms and Latin music to Asian classical traditions, electronic fusion, jazz, reggae, folk, indigenous performances, and experimental collaborations.
Beyond live performances, visitors can participate in interactive workshops, cultural discussions, storytelling sessions, poetry readings, wellness activities, craft demonstrations, and educational talks. Every activity is designed to encourage learning, appreciation of different cultures, and meaningful engagement.
Family-Friendly Festival
WOMAD has established itself as one of the UK's leading family festivals. Dedicated children's areas provide creative workshops, arts and crafts, music sessions, educational activities, theatre performances, and interactive experiences suitable for young visitors. Families can enjoy a welcoming environment with facilities designed for comfort and convenience throughout the event.
Food and International Cuisine
Visitors can explore an impressive selection of international cuisine representing cultures from across the world. Food vendors serve authentic dishes prepared using fresh ingredients, while cooking demonstrations introduce audiences to traditional recipes and culinary techniques. Vegetarian, vegan, gluten-free, and specialty dietary options are widely available, making the festival inclusive for diverse dietary preferences.

Visitor Facilities
The Neston Park venue offers well-organized camping areas, food courts, accessible pathways, family zones, information centres, medical support, parking facilities, charging stations, and numerous visitor amenities. Festival staff and volunteers work throughout the event to ensure guests enjoy a safe, comfortable, and memorable experience.
Accessibility services include dedicated viewing platforms, accessible camping options, wheelchair support, and facilities designed to accommodate visitors with additional mobility requirements. These services help make the festival welcoming for people of all abilities.
